解决clash无法增加配置的问题

概述

在现代网络世界中,越来越多的人开始使用代理工具来优化网络连接的速度与安全性,其中 clash 作为一种流行的选择,因其强大的功能而深受用户喜爱。然而,许多用户在使用 clash 时遇到一个常见的问题——无法增加配置。这会导致无法自定义代理规则,影响到用户的网络体验。本文将详细探讨这一问题的原因及相应解决方案。

什么是clash?

Clash 是一个代理客户端,支持多种协议,具有高效的规则引擎和灵活的配置管理,积极配合用户的个别需求。通过 clash,用户可以改善境外访问、加速游戏下载等多种用途。

clash无法增加配置的常见原因

1. 配置文件权限不足

  • 确保配置文件的读写权限正常。需要有管理员权限才能修改某些文件。

2. 配置格式不正确

  • 配置文件一般是以 YAML 格式编写的,若格式不对或者标识符错误,将会导致 clash 无法读取或解析配置。

3. 依赖外部资源

  • 若你的配置 file 使用了外部 URL 来增加配置,这些外部资源的不可用也可能导致整个配置失败。

4. dash选项设置不当

  • 在某些状态下必须根据不同的需求做适当的调整,否则会让程序拿不到更新后的配置。

排查与解决方案

步骤一:查看文件权限

  1. 找到配置文件(一般为 config.yaml),右击文件,选择“属性” >“安全”标签。
  2. 查看和确认权限。用户需要有“读取”和“写入”权限。

步骤二:检查配置文件的格式

  • 使用在线 YAML 校验工具,确保文件无任何格式错误。常见错误包括:
    • 缺少冒号
    • 多余的空格
    • 不规范的标识币及排列格式。

步骤三:确认依赖的资源

  • 访问外部资源的链接 verify 其有效性。
  • 尝试 ping 外部链接确认可达性,如果访问受限,则需要更换配置源。

步骤四:调整dash选项

  • clash 的设置中,锁定dash部分并合理设置。
    • 比如,确保 delay min/max 设置合理与正确以获得有效的配置。

防止clash无法增加配置的技巧

  • 保持项目更新 : 定期检查 clash 是否更新到最新版本。
  • 备份配置文件 : 每次修改前备份,以免丢失数据。
  • 学习Daniel’s rule模式 : 分层管理代理规则,直观简约,有助于避免规则冲突。

FAQ

问题一:如何正确添加新的配置到clash中?

  • 打开 config.yaml 文件,按照YAML 格式添加规则或节点,添加完成后保存并重启 clash 否则配置不会生效。

问题二:文件格式出错了,还可以恢复吗?

  • 若是您在更改配置时出现了出错,可以通过备份文件进行恢复,及时用有效的配置文件覆盖错误的文件内容。

问题三:依赖的URL无法访问,是否有其他办法增加配置?

  • 如果某一个外部URL访问失败,可以寻找其他公共 FRP 服务。在界定公益用途的前提下,可以引进一些公开的模板或仓库。 欢迎使用自建代理以确保稳定性。

问题四:如何在移动设备上进行配置?

  • 通常可以在移动设备上安装第三方应用程序,比如安卓的 Clash For Android, 上述注意事项依旧适用,使用路径仅不同。

结语

在使用 clash 的过程中,很多用户们会遭遇各种各样的障碍,其中无法增加配置信息是常见的一种。通过合理的排查以及细致的修正大部分问题能够得到解决。希望本文对您解决 bonus动力 klash的问题有所帮助。如有不明之处建议常去相关论坛互相查问。减少挫败感,以享受网络带来的便利资源;同时不停给孩子们强化安全意识 !

正文完
 0